At a glance

Dimension Security and Fire Alarm Systems Installers Avionics Technicians
Median pay $59,300 $81,390
Employment 81,510 20,900
Employment outlook (2024–34) · BLS projection Growing fast (+10.4%) Growing fast (+8.2%)
Annual openings · BLS projection 9,400 1,800
Typical education · O*NET Most occupations in this zone require training in vocational schools, related on-the-job experience, or an associate's degree. Most occupations in this zone require training in vocational schools, related on-the-job experience, or an associate's degree.
AI exposure · published exposure studies Moderate · 55th pct Moderate · 46th pct
Global GenAI gradient · ILO ISCO-08 · via crosswalk 24th pct · 17% of tasks 46th pct · 25% of tasks
Observed AI use · Anthropic Economic Index Automation-leaning (44.9%)
Mostly remote-capable · Dingel–Neiman No No

Pay and employment are BLS OEWS estimates; outlook and openings are BLS 2024–2034 projections; AI exposure and observed-use figures come from separate research and reflect exposure and usage, not predictions that either job will disappear. Compare like with like.

Skills

Shared: Public Safety and Security, Oral Comprehension, Problem Sensitivity, Computers and Electronics, Customer and Personal Service, Telecommunications, Oral Expression, Near Vision, Speaking, Critical Thinking, Deductive Reasoning, Information Ordering, Arm-Hand Steadiness, Manual Dexterity, Active Listening, Inductive Reasoning, Engineering and Technology, Reading Comprehension, Complex Problem Solving, Operations Monitoring, Quality Control Analysis, Judgment and Decision Making, Visualization, Finger Dexterity, Speech Recognition, Speech Clarity, English Language, Mechanical, Education and Training, Monitoring, Troubleshooting, Repairing, Time Management, Written Comprehension, Written Expression.

Specific to Security and Fire Alarm Systems Installers

  • Installation
  • Building and Construction
  • Category Flexibility
  • Multilimb Coordination
  • Extent Flexibility

Specific to Avionics Technicians

  • Equipment Maintenance
  • Design
  • Mathematics
  • Control Precision
  • Writing

Knowledge, skills & abilities O*NET rates as important for each occupation. “Shared” are common to both; the columns list what is distinctive to each (top by the order O*NET surfaces).
